AMR files are a type of compressed audio file. They were developed by Ericsson and are commonly found in phones, where these files are used to store spoken audio such as voice recordings and similar content. They can also store MMS messages.
The algorithm used to compress the audio in these files is specifically geared towards human speech – because of this, the format is particularly suited to this task. There are two types of this file – the wideband and narrowband options. The wideband option provides better sound quality (at the cost of larger file sizes) as it’s able to support a broader frequency of audio.
How can you open AMR files?
AMR files can be opened with a wide variety of audio players. They can also be used and opened by most mobile devices built by Ericsson – which means mostly Sony Ericsson phones. Proprietary audio software will also be able to open these files.
What programs work with AMR files?
A wide variety of sound playing programs can play AMR files – among them software like VLC media player, Audacity, Apple Quick Time player and more. Additionally, some file viewing software such as File Viewer Plus will be able to play these files.
